Initially, coats of arms were granted to individuals and not to an entire lineage, relating to the person who had obtained them for merit, military exploits or social position. Over time, the emblem of Falone became hereditary, becoming an iconic symbol of family lineage and becoming indivisibly linked to the surname Falone.
Legacy: Although the heraldic shield may be related to Falone, it is essential to keep in mind that historically these were granted to particular individuals. Therefore, not all individuals with the surname Falone are automatically entitled to the crest associated with it, unless they can prove a direct lineage to the original holder of the crest. It is also important to mention that there may be different shields for the surname Falone, since they could have been granted to people from different families with the same surname Falone.
Variation in shields: Family members who bear the surname Falone can observe that there are different variations in heraldic shields. These variations usually represent the diversity between different family branches, generations or individual titles that have been granted throughout history.
